How would you describe the work you do and why?: 

My silver and brass jewellery is sculpture-inspired, using processes such as Lost Wax Casting - I create entirely unique pieces by melting and pouring silver. My artistic background is in sculpture and I am inspired by the natural world and how light interacts with landscapes and rock formations. My minimalist designs are made by hand with an organic and rustic finish.

For you what does being an artist mean?: 

Being a sculptor and jeweller is a way to materialise my thoughts, making with my hands and being creative is my way of understanding the world around me.

Your practice & activities include e.g workshops, teaching: 

My jewellery is made through two different processes, one is hammering and shaping and the other being 'Lost Wax Casting', an ancient technique using wax modelling, casting sand and melted silver.
